How To Watch Team Canada At The Atlas Cup

Oshawa, ON – This weekend, four of the top lacrosse nations in the world will meet for the Atlas Cup, hosted by USA Lacrosse in Sparks, Maryland. Team Canada will face off against Puerto Rico, Haudenosaunee, and the USA in three action-packed days of men’s and women’s Sixes that fans won’t want to miss. Canadian stars like Jeff Teat, Brett Dobson, Erica Evans, and Brooklyn Walker-Welch headline the rosters.

This tournament marks the first time Canada, Haudenosaunee, and the USA have all competed at the same Sixes event since the 2022 World Games in Birmingham, Alabama, where Canada captured gold in both men’s and women’s Sixes.

The games will be streamed on USA Lacrosse youtube channel which can be found HERE along with the schedule being available below. Watch from home as Canada continues their Sixes journey on the road to the 2028 Olympics in LA.

Friday, Sept. 26

GameTime (ET)
Women: Canada vs Puerto Rico4:00 pm
Men: Canada vs Haudenosaunee5:30 pm
Men: Puerto Rico vs USA7:00 pm
Women: Haudenosaunee vs USA8:30 pm

Saturday, Sept. 27

GameTime (ET)
Men: Haudenosaunee vs Puerto Rico4:00 pm
Women: Canada vs Haudenosaunee5:30 pm
Women: Puerto Rico vs USA7:00 pm
Men: Canada vs USA8:30 pm

Sunday, Sept. 28

GameTime (ET)
Women: Haudenosaunee vs Puerto Rico9:00 am
Women: Canada vs USA10:30 am
Men: Canada vs Puerto Rico12:00 pm
Men: Haudenosaunee vs USA1:30 pm

ABOUT LACROSSE CANADA

Lacrosse Canada is the national governing body for Lacrosse in Canada, dedicated to the promotion, development, and preservation of the sport at all levels. As stewards of Canada’s national summer sport, Lacrosse Canada oversees national championships, high-performance programs, and the country’s representation on the international stage.
